Funktionreferenz


_DateTimeFormat

Beschreibung anzeigen in

Gibt das Datum abhängig von der in der Systemeinstellung gewählten Ländereinstellung zurück

#include <Date.au3>
_DateTimeFormat ( $sDate, $sType )

Parameter

$sDate Format der Datumseingabe "YYYY/MM/DD[HH:MM:SS]"
$sType einer der folgenden Werte:
0 - Zeigt Datum und/oder Zeit. Zeigt das Datum, wenn angegeben, als Kurzanzeige.
Zeigt die Zeit, wenn angegeben, im Langformat. Zeigt beides an, wenn beides angegeben ist.
1 - Zeigt das Datum in dem in den Ländereinstellungen eingestellten Langformat.
2 - Zeigt das Datum in dem in den Ländereinstellungen eingestellten Kurzformat.
3 - Zeigt die Zeit in dem in den Ländereinstellungen eingestellten Zeitformat.
4 - Zeigt die Zeit im 24-Stunden Format (HH:MM).
5 - Zeigt die Zeit mit Sekunden im 24-Stunden Format (HH:MM:SS).

Rückgabewert

Erfolg: das Datum im geeigneten Format
Fehler: 0 und setzt das @error Flag auf ungleich null
@error: 1 - $sDate ungültig
2 - $sType ungültig

Bemerkungen

Siehe _DateTimeSplit() für andere mögliche Datumsformate.

Verwandte Funktionen

_NowDate, _NowTime

Beispiel

#include <Date.au3>
#include <MsgBoxConstants.au3>

; Zeigt das Datum in dem PC Format.
MsgBox($MB_SYSTEMMODAL, "Langes PC Format", _DateTimeFormat(_NowCalc(), 1))
MsgBox($MB_SYSTEMMODAL, "Kurzes PC Format", _DateTimeFormat(_NowCalc(), 2))